Auto Vacuum and Mop Combos
The most effective auto vacuum and mop are designed for hands-free cleaning. They're compatible with smart home systems and can be programmed using apps. They also have virtual boundaries. Some, like the eufy Omni X2, can even wash and dry mop pad after use.
These models come with 8000Pa suction and mopping into one device, making them an efficient alternative for cleaning up daily. How do they compare with their conventional counterparts?
Convenience
The majority of the top robotic vacuums and mops available do both tasks at once and eliminate the necessity for separate cleaning tools. These smart machines clean according to a pre-determined schedule and operate independently.
The majority of robot vacuums that come with mops come with advanced mapping capabilities and obstacles-avoiding technologies that allow you to navigate and clean floors thoroughly without hitting furniture or other obstacles. These robot vacuums with mops have adjustable water levels as well as a self-emptying mop pads washer station, and other features to make maintenance easier. The high-efficiency filters of certain models help reduce the spread of fine dust particles throughout the home.
Certain advanced mopping options allow you to alter the amount of water and scrubbing power your robot makes use of, while other features can detect the presence of stains and automatically alter cleaning settings. You can also control the robot's mop and vacuum with an app. This lets you select specific areas to clean, or create scenes like "vacuum playroom" and "vacuum dining area."
Most advanced robotic vacuums and mops in this price range offer enhanced smart home integration, which includes voice assistants such as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ant or Apple HomeKit. They come with more sophisticated applications that allow you to save your home's maps, set cleaning schedules, and select different cleaning modes. Some of them allow you to stop cleaning and then resume it if the battery is depleted.
If you have a larger home, you'll want to select the robot vacuums with mop vacuum and mop with an extended runtime so that it can finish the job on time. Select a model that can automatically return to its original location and recharge to extend its time of operation. Or choose an option with removable batteries so you can change the battery as needed.
Most robotic vacuums equipped with mop heads require regular maintenance to ensure they are operating at optimal performance and lengthen their lives. This includes cleaning the filter and untangling the brushes. The app for certain models will let you know when maintenance is due, making it easier to handle these tasks. Some mops, like those from ECOVACS, have an auto-empty OMNI station as well as ZeroTangle Anti-Tangle Technology to further reduce the frequency of these chores.
Durability
A vacuum and mop can make short work of tough messy messes, but you need to choose one that won't break or wear out easily. These units, like all robotic vacuums require regular maintenance to operate efficiently. The dustbin needs to be cleaned and empty periodically, as well as the mop pads being regularly cleaned or replaced. Most also have a drained water tank that has to be cleaned out and machine-washed whenever it's full to prevent mildew or odor.
Unlike the simplest robot vacuums, which employ simple brooms and pads to collect dirt and debris most of today's top auto vacuum and mop robots come with active pad systems that scrub floors with a more intensive action. This includes a spinning floor pad that is electronically activated via a wringing system to continuously agitate your floors. This helps to remove the dirt and stains embedded in the floor. In addition to this dynamic pad technology, many of these robots come with advanced sensors to help them navigate more efficiently and recognize different flooring surfaces, so they can adjust their cleaning paths accordingly.
Some of the best-rated robotic vacuums and mop models can clean hard and carpeted surfaces in one go. This is especially beneficial if you have pets or children who often drop toys or food on the floor. These units are fitted with mop pads that automatically switch into sweep mode when they spot carpeted areas. The mop pads will then return to the dock to empty out dirty water and replenish with cleaning solution before returning to sweep your home.
Other features you might want to think about when selecting an mop and auto vacuum include remote control via an app, the option to customize cleaning settings in your home and smart alerts that inform you of a low battery or empty tank. There are also models that make use of smartphones to scan QR codes on your mop pads and refill stations for easier installation and maintenance.

Cleaning Schedules
Many smart vacuums and mop systems have features such as scheduling options that let homeowners customize cleaning robot mop and vacuum schedules to suit their requirements. If you have a big home with multiple floors, your robot cleaner could need to be run more frequently and for longer time periods. This will ensure that you keep your home clean without going overboard.
If you have children, it's important to schedule your cleaners more frequently since they tend to bring dirt in from outside or make messes at home. In this case running the device 3-4 times a week should suffice to keep your home clean and tidy.
Your smartphone can be used to develop a cleaning routine for your automatic vacuum and mop. This will ensure that your home remains clean and fresh. Utilizing the app, you can keep track of the progress of cleaning and alter the settings as needed. For instance, you can change the setting of your vacuum to high pile when cleaning carpets and lower on tile or hardwood floors to maximize cleaning efficiency.
Virtual Boundaries
A smart auto vacuum and mop with mapping technology is a game-changer for anyone living in a multi-story house. Dreame's mapping feature and virtual boundaries feature allows you to design "no-go" zones for your robot hoover without the necessity of tape or physical barriers. You can create boundaries by using the drawing tools available in the app to create straight or curved lines that stop your robot from entering certain spaces. This is a great way to keep your robot away from areas with fragile items, pet bowls and other spaces that you don't want them to enter.
Users report that Dreame vacuums clean faster with this advanced navigational technology. They also say that their smart vacuums require less time to complete a cleaning cycle compared to non-mapping models.
You can establish a virtual boundary for your Dreame at anytime. It is best robotic mop and vacuum to do this once the area is clean and clear of obstructions. Before beginning the cleaning process, make sure that your robot has an accurate map and that all doors are opened. In the app, choose the icon that looks like a wall or no-go zone and then use your finger to draw the boundary. Once you save the boundaries in the app and your robot will follow them throughout subsequent cleaning cycles.
Keep your robot's sensors clean for optimal mapping and navigating performance. Clean the charging contacts on your dock and the sensor bars in the vacuum regularly to prevent debris accumulation that could affect the accuracy of mapping or even movement. Make sure you regularly clean and inspect the wheels of your robot in order to maintain their good working condition. Recalibrating your robotic device regularly will increase the accuracy of mapping and navigation.
